What if school actually taught you how to handle real life?
Being a teenager means you're not a kid anymore -- but you're not quite an adult either. And somehow, people expect you to be both.
Let's be real: growing up is messy, confusing, and full of things no one ever teaches you. One minute you're figuring out friendships, and the next you're expected to understand money, emotional triggers, or how to stay calm when life throws a curveball.
That's where this book comes in.
Teen Life Skills Survival Guide is a practical, no-fluff teen life skills guide designed to help you build confidence, strengthen communication skills, and develop the real-world skills you need to navigate everyday life.
Inside, you'll learn how to:
• Build better habits that support your mental and physical health
• Boost your confidence and stop spiraling when comparison hits
• Communicate clearly, set boundaries, and speak up for yourself
• Stay safe and smart online (yes, even when algorithms are doing the most)
• Manage money, think critically, and make real-world decisions with less stress
Along the way, you'll hear from Mateo -- your chill, older-brother-style guide who's been through it and gets it. His voice shows up throughout the book to keep things honest, encouraging, and just the right amount of sarcastic.
Whether you're feeling overwhelmed, stuck, or just ready to start figuring things out, this guide helps you build confidence, resilience, and the life skills that actually matter -- one step at a time.
Includes scannable QR codes with bonus resources like videos, reflection tools, and interactive activities
Includes an Adult Allies section with guidance for parents, teachers, and mentors supporting teens
